Abstract
The strength of the perforated sieve of a vibrating screen is investigated based on the analysis of its stress–strain state in the SolidWorks environment. Based on the results of the study, optimization of the sieve parameters is proposed, aimed at increasing the effectiveness of the material screening process without reducing reliability owing to increasing the net area ratio of the sieving surface.
